2019-03-26 · Our children and grandchildren are shaped by the genes they inherit from us, but new research is revealing that experiences of hardship or violence can leave their mark too.
This Swedish study shows that there might be some sort of epigenetic response to stress or famine at particular times in our lives, allowing us to adapt to different circumstances from one generation to the next; in effect a short-term response system allowing subsequent generations to respond epigenetically to threats faced by our parents or grandparents.
The fascinating field of epigenetics studies how different environmental influences actually have the power to change gene expressions in our DNA. Recently, a team of researchers discovered that mothers who experienced a physical hardship such as famine undergo a change in their DNA, which they pass on for up to three generations. the long-term effects of feast and famine on children growing up in the isolated Swedish county of Norrbotten, with the goal to unravel whether “Parents’ experiences early in their lives change the traits they passed to their offspring” [10]. In the 19th century, Norrbotten was so isolated that if the harvest failed, people starved. However, epigenetic mutations, here defined as aberrant methylation levels compared to the distribution in a population, are less understood. Hence, we investigated longitudinal accumulation of epigenetic mutations, using 994 blood samples collected at up to five time points from 375 individuals in old ages.
